Madera freshman Destinee Avila connects on a base hit in the seventh inning of Tuesday’s NorCal playoff loss to Central Catholic in Modesto.
In their first forays into the CIF NorCal State Championships, both the Central Section-winning Liberty Hawks baseball team and Madera Coyotes softball team fell in its first games earlier this week.
The Liberty Hawks earned a home game with a No. 4 seed in the Div. III NorCal State Championships, and lost, 3-2, to the fifth-seeded Oakmont-Rosevelle Vikings on Tuesday.
Meanwhile, the Coyotes were seeded seventh in the NorCal Div. III playoffs, and ran into a tough pitcher from 2nd-seeded Central Catholic-Modesto in a 3-0 loss Tuesday.
